Meet Miss Dottie!
Dottie is a 10-week-old mastiff mix weighing in at 12 pounds 8 ounces (as of 11/17/25). She’s a sweet, spunky puppy who loves everyone she meets! Dottie is great with dogs, cats, and kids, and she’s already sleeping through the night like a champ.

She’s currently working on her potty training and doing well for her age. Dottie is in her teething era, so she’ll need plenty of chew toys, treats, and fun activities to keep her busy.

If you’re looking for a lovable, happy little girl who will grow into a wonderful companion, Dottie is your girl.

More about this rescue

At Halfway There Rescue, we are a volunteer-run organization dedicated to making a difference for animals in North and South Carolina. Our mission focuses on reducing overcrowding in local open intake shelters while promoting the importance of spaying and neutering through community partnerships. We work tirelessly to provide compassionate care, foster opportunities, and life-saving interventions for pets in need. By engaging with the community, we aim to create a future where every animal has a safe, loving home. Together, we can reduce the burden on shelters and ensure a brighter future for all.
